    Deep Analysis

    SENTIMENT ASSESSMENT

    Overall sentiment for Apple (AAPL) is moderately positive, despite recent year-to-date underperformance. The composite sentiment score of 0.1711, coupled with a positive 5-day return of 0.55%, indicates a slight upward trend in sentiment. The put/call ratio of 0.851 suggests a bullish bias among options traders, with more calls being bought than puts. While the stock has lagged the broader S&P 500 significantly YTD, recent news flow, particularly regarding product innovation and legal victories, is contributing to a more optimistic outlook.

    KEY THEMES

    * Product Innovation & Future Pipeline: Strong speculation around Apple preparing its first foldable iPhone for a 2026 launch, as suggested by Bank of America’s supply chain checks. This signals a potential new product category and future growth driver.

    * Legal & Regulatory Clarity: A significant legal win for Apple, with a U.S. trade tribunal ruling that the latest Apple Watch models do not infringe on Masimo’s patents. This removes an immediate risk of an import ban and secures a key revenue stream.

    * iPhone Demand & Market Share Resilience: Analysts, such as Morgan Stanley’s Erik Woodring, anticipate Apple will be the only major global smartphone maker to gain market share this year, indicating robust demand despite broader market challenges.

    * AI Integration & Competition: Google’s move to bring a dedicated Gemini AI app to Macs highlights the intensifying AI competition and the expectation for Apple to further integrate advanced AI capabilities into its ecosystem.

    * Analyst Confidence: Bank of America reiterated its ‘Buy’ rating on AAPL, albeit with a modest price target reduction, reflecting continued long-term confidence in the company’s prospects.

    RISKS

    * Year-to-Date Underperformance: AAPL has significantly underperformed the S&P 500, losing approximately 7% YTD compared to the S&P 500’s 3.82% decline. This trend could persist if new catalysts fail to materialize strongly.

    * Intensifying AI Competition: Google’s aggressive push with Gemini on Mac could put pressure on Apple to accelerate its own AI strategy and announcements, potentially leading to increased R&D costs or market perception of lagging innovation.

    * Price Target Adjustments: While BofA maintained a ‘Buy’ rating, the modest lowering of its price target from $325 to $320 suggests some recalibration of expectations, which could be a subtle negative signal.

    * Broader Market Headwinds: The general market downturn (S&P 500 also down YTD) indicates a challenging economic environment that could continue to exert pressure on even strong companies like Apple.

    CATALYSTS

    * Foldable iPhone Confirmation/Launch: Official announcements or further concrete details regarding a foldable iPhone could generate significant excitement and drive future revenue expectations.

    * Stronger-than-Expected iPhone Sales: Continued market share gains and robust demand for current and upcoming iPhone models could positively impact earnings.

    * AI Strategy & Product Integration: Any significant announcements from Apple regarding its AI strategy, new AI-powered features, or partnerships could re-rate the stock, especially given the market’s current focus on AI.

    * Favorable Regulatory Environment: Continued positive legal outcomes, like the Apple Watch ruling, reduce uncertainty and protect revenue streams.

    * Analyst Upgrades/Positive Revisions: Further positive analyst commentary, particularly if price targets are raised, could boost investor confidence.

    CONTRARIAN VIEW

    Despite the recent positive news flow (Apple Watch ruling, foldable iPhone rumors, strong iPhone demand outlook), the stock’s significant year-to-date underperformance suggests that the market may be discounting these positives or focusing on other underlying concerns not explicitly detailed in the provided articles. This could include broader macroeconomic pressures, potential weakness in key markets like China, or a perceived lack of a clear, leading-edge AI strategy compared to some peers. The modest reduction in Bank of America’s price target, even with a ‘Buy’ rating, could be interpreted as a subtle signal of tempered growth expectations, suggesting that even positive developments might not translate into immediate, substantial upside.

    PRICE IMPACT ESTIMATE

    Given the moderately positive composite sentiment, bullish put/call ratio, and recent positive news regarding product innovation (foldable iPhone rumors) and legal clarity (Apple Watch ruling), the short-term price impact is estimated to be moderately positive. The stock’s recent 0.55% 5-day return aligns with this. While the YTD underperformance is a concern, the current news flow provides catalysts that could help AAPL regain some momentum. Expect a slight upward bias, potentially testing resistance levels, as investors digest the positive developments and look past the recent lag.

    Deep Analysis

    SENTIMENT ASSESSMENT

    The overall sentiment for Broadcom (AVGO) is predominantly positive, as indicated by a composite sentiment score of 0.2435 and a flurry of bullish articles. The market is increasingly recognizing AVGO as a significant, albeit potentially “underrated,” player in the burgeoning Artificial Intelligence (AI) hardware space. News highlights include a doubling of AI revenue to $8.4 billion and strong earnings growth projections, with one article suggesting a jump from $5 to $20 per share in the coming year. Analyst sentiment is also strong, with Cantor Fitzgerald maintaining an Overweight rating and a $525 price target following Q1 2026 earnings.

    However, a notable contrarian signal emerges from the options market, with a put/call ratio of 1.2603. This indicates a higher volume of put options relative to calls, suggesting that a segment of investors is either hedging against potential downside or actively betting on a price decline, despite the overwhelmingly positive news flow.

    KEY THEMES

    * AI Revenue Explosion: Broadcom’s AI revenue has reportedly doubled to $8.4 billion, positioning it as a major beneficiary of the AI boom. Its partnership with Alphabet for chip design is a key highlight.

    * Underrated AI Play: Several articles suggest AVGO is an under-the-radar AI hardware stock with significant growth potential, despite its recent “pop.”

    * Strong Earnings Growth: Projections for earnings per share show substantial growth, from $5 last year to a potential $20 next year, fueling investor optimism.

    * Analyst Confidence: Cantor Fitzgerald’s maintained Overweight rating and $525 price target post-Q1 2026 earnings underscore Wall Street’s positive outlook.

    * Broader Semiconductor & Tech Tailwinds: AVGO benefits from a general rally in the semiconductor sector (Nvidia, AMD) and the broader tech market (QQQ), supported by easing geopolitical tensions and a “buy the dip” mentality after recent market corrections.

    * Data Center & Connectivity: While not explicitly detailed for AVGO, the broader theme of AI-driven solutions and strong data center growth in related companies (MRVL, OKTA) suggests a favorable environment for AVGO’s connectivity and infrastructure offerings.

    RISKS

    * Options Market Bearishness: The elevated put/call ratio (1.2603) is a significant risk, indicating that a portion of the market anticipates a pullback or is hedging against potential negative events, which contradicts the overwhelmingly positive news.

    * Sustainability of AI Growth: While current AI revenue growth is impressive, the long-term sustainability and competitive landscape in the rapidly evolving AI chip market could pose challenges.

    * Execution Risk: Achieving the projected earnings growth (e.g., $5 to $20 EPS) requires flawless execution and continued strong demand, which may be difficult to maintain.

    * Market Overheating/Correction: Despite the current rally, the broader tech and semiconductor sectors could be susceptible to profit-taking or a wider market correction, impacting AVGO regardless of its fundamentals.

    * Competition: While AVGO is highlighted, the semiconductor space is highly competitive, with other major players like Nvidia and AMD also vying for AI market share.

    CATALYSTS

    * Continued AI Revenue Outperformance: Further announcements of strong AI-related revenue growth or new design wins with major tech companies (like Alphabet) would be significant catalysts.

    * Exceeding Earnings Guidance: Delivering Q2 2026 earnings that surpass current analyst expectations and management guidance would likely drive the stock higher.

    * Analyst Upgrades & Price Target Revisions: Further positive revisions to price targets or upgrades from other prominent financial institutions could provide additional momentum.

    * New Product Announcements: Introduction of innovative AI-driven chip solutions or expanded portfolio offerings that solidify AVGO’s market position.

    * Sustained Tech Sector Rally: A continued bullish trend in the broader technology and semiconductor markets, fueled by economic stability and easing geopolitical concerns, would provide a favorable backdrop.

    CONTRARIAN VIEW

    Despite the overwhelmingly positive news flow regarding Broadcom’s AI growth and earnings potential, the elevated put/call ratio of 1.2603 suggests a notable degree of caution or outright bearish sentiment among options traders. This could imply that some investors believe the recent “pop” in the stock price has already priced in much of the good news, making it vulnerable to profit-taking. Alternatively, it could reflect concerns about the sustainability of the current market rally, potential competitive pressures in the AI chip space that are not fully captured by current headlines, or a belief that the stock is becoming overvalued despite being labeled “underrated.” This segment of the market may be anticipating a short-term correction or hedging against unforeseen negative developments.

    PRICE IMPACT ESTIMATE

    Given the strong positive sentiment driven by robust AI revenue growth, significant earnings projections, and analyst confidence, the immediate price impact for AVGO is likely positive. The stock has already “popped today” according to one article, and the $525 price target from Cantor Fitzgerald suggests further upside from its current (unspecified) price.

    However, the elevated put/call ratio introduces a degree of caution, indicating potential resistance or a higher likelihood of short-term volatility and pullbacks as some investors may look to take profits or hedge against perceived overextension. While the fundamental narrative points to continued appreciation, the options market suggests that the path higher might not be entirely smooth. Expect upward pressure in the near term, but with potential for increased volatility or temporary corrections due to hedging activity.
